How to reach Skyline Luge Singapore by bus: routes, stops, and transfer tips
From the city center, the fastest option is to head to HarbourFront Interchange, switch to the island shuttle, and alight near Imbiah Lookout. That approach keeps travel light and efficient, allowing families, hotel guests, and travelers alone to start their day with a memorable outing and reach the gateway within half an hour under typical traffic.
Transit steps
Key stops along the way include HarbourFront Interchange (city-side hub), VivoCity bus stops for transfers, Beach Station on the coast, and the Imbiah Lookout entrance where the ride is located. From Imbiah Lookout, the entry is a short walk of 5–8 minutes; from Beach Station, plan 15–20 minutes on foot or via a short internal shuttle hop.
Tips and planning

Use online planning tools (MyTransport.SG or Google Maps) to view live times and plan alternates, allowing you to compare options and arrive faster. Booking options for tours that include transport to the island can be found online, helping when there are many users in a group. Ticketing typically uses EZ-Link or contactless cards; cash fares are also possible but may be less convenient. Return timing matters, so check last bus times to avoid a long wait.
Pricing and options: mainland bus fare with card is usually around SGD 1.50–2.50; internal island shuttles are free, which is an addition that keeps longer visits affordable. What to expect on the Luge ride: track options, duration, and rider limits
Tövsiyə: Start with the Green Scenic track for your first ride to build confidence; after you’re comfortable, switch to the Red Challenge. This outdoor activity operates on a hilltop via a lift to the start, then a fast descent through wide bends and sharp corners, yielding scenic coastal views and a beachside perspective.
Track options: Two primary courses are available: Green Scenic (gentle curves, moderate speed) and Red Challenge (tighter turns, higher pace). For riders who prefer variety, you can choose which pace to target. Both options deliver impressive scenery and a range of ride feels, so these choices let you adjust based on pace and comfort, considering whether you ride independently or with others.
Duration and flow: Just 2–3 minutes per run, with the return lift adding 3–5 minutes. Expect about 30–40 minutes for the full experience, including queue time and a possible photo session. If you plan more than one ride, purchasing a multi-ride deal or a combo package can save money versus buying separately. These deals often include a small souvenir or photo, perks that many guests value.
Rider limits: Safety rules require riders to meet height and weight guidelines and to follow staff instructions. Typical minimum height is around 110 cm, with a maximum weight near 130 kg; age rules vary, with younger riders needing an adult present. Single riders per cart are standard, though some tracks offer tandem options for children with supervision; riding independently is allowed only when you can handle the sled safely. The exact requirements are posted at the loading area, and staff can advise if you’re unsure.

Safety guidelines and age/height requirements for riders
The minimum age and height must be met before starting; verify these figures at the store during booking and again on arrival to avoid delays or refunds disqualification.
-
Age and height eligibility: Typical minimum age is around 6 years and minimum height about 110 cm, with exact numbers varying by route and season. They may require an accompanying adult for younger riders, and both child and adult must meet the criteria. Check the banners at the store and confirm during booking to be sure.
-
Mandatory helmets and gear: Helmets are required for every rider. Ensure a snug fit and secure the chin strap; remove loose scarves or jewelry before starting; long hair should be tied back. This keeps safety conditions consistent for all riders.
-
Clothing and personal items: Wear closed‑toe shoes and long pants or sleeves when possible; avoid loose clothing and dangling accessories. Secure valuables in lockers available at the store to prevent loss during the ride.
-
Medical and personal conditions: People with back, neck, heart, or respiratory conditions, pregnancy, recent surgeries, or intoxication should avoid riding. If in doubt, seek medical advice before visiting; they will advise alternatives that suit both seekers and casual visitors.
-
Weight and physical suitability: Weight and balance limits are enforced for safety; riders outside the approved range cannot participate. If you’re unsure about eligibility, ask staff at the store before starting.
-
Starting times and flexible timings: Arrive 15–20 minutes before your assigned slot; timings may shift due to weather or crowds. If you’re running late, contact the store to check whether a later slot is still available.
-
Behavior and safety rules: No alcohol or drugs inside the area; follow all staff instructions; keep hands and feet inside the ride vehicle; secure loose items; discourage risky maneuvers that could affect others.

Weather effects and practical tips
Weather does influence pace, grip, and visibility on the course. In light rain, the track remains rideable but damp sections slow braking and require extra caution; always observe the lookout for notices at the entrance. Heat and humidity raise sweat levels, so wear light clothing and stay hydrated; simple sun protection helps, especially for those standing in sun during the skyride ascent. Helmets are provided on entry to ensure safety for all riders; if you wear glasses, secure them appropriately. Wind and lightning can pause the skyride to westbound top sections, so check the forecast and date before you go. The tunnels along the route provide shade and a cooler contrast to exposed segments, which adds to the experience from a city viewpoint.
